Aviation Aircraft-on-Ground (AOG) emergencies demand speed, reliability, and absolute accountability. When an aircraft is grounded due to a missing component or urgent spare part, every hour costs airlines thousands of pounds. Cheltenham-based businesses—whether aerospace suppliers, maintenance contractors, or logistics coordinators—need a same-day courier partner that understands the pressure and complexity of aviation logistics.

What We Handle for Aviation AOG from Cheltenham

Aviation AOG cargo spans a wide range of components, weights, and regulatory categories. Typical items include:

  • Engine components and assemblies: turbine blades, fuel nozzles, seal kits, valve bodies
  • Landing gear and hydraulic units: actuators, cylinders, pressure regulators, brake assemblies
  • Avionics and electrical parts: circuit cards, wire harnesses, control units, sensor assemblies
  • Cabin and structural components: panels, fasteners, ducting, interior fittings
  • Tooling and support equipment: specialised test rigs, documentation sets, calibration gear
  • Consumables and spare kits: fluid packs, seal kits, filter sets, emergency supplies

Items typically range from a few hundred grams (individual circuit cards) to 50 kg (small assemblies or multiple boxes); larger palletised loads are accommodated on our standard vehicles or via partner carrier networks. All shipments move under full insurance cover (up to £1M via specialist partner carriers), signed proof of delivery, and GPS tracking.

Regulatory context: aviation cargo in the UK must comply with IATA regulations, especially for any items classified as restricted goods (lithium batteries, fluids, corrosives). We work with same-day courier standards and coordinate with authorised cargo handlers at UK airports to ensure compliant handover at destination.

Typical Cheltenham-Area Corridors and Connections

Cheltenham's geography offers fast, direct access to the UK's primary aviation hubs and cargo gateways:

Via the M5 Southbound: Junction 10 (Cheltenham) to Heathrow cargo areas is approximately 90 miles via Junction 15 (M4 interchange). This route is heavily used for next-day and same-day spares reaching UK flag-carrier and international airline operations. Journey time: 90–110 minutes in routine conditions.

To Gatwick: M5 south through Junction 15 then M25 anticlockwise, approximately 110 miles. Gatwick is a major cargo hub for Asian and Gulf airline operations, with high AOG frequency from Asian manufacturers. Journey time: 110–140 minutes.

To East Midlands Airport (EMA): Via M5 northbound then M1 northbound, approximately 55 miles. EMA is the UK's largest domestic cargo hub and a key consolidation point for European parts. Journey time: 65–80 minutes.

To Bristol Airport / Cargo Facilities: A40 southwest to Bristol, approximately 40 miles. Used for next-leg UK regional distribution and European flight connections. Journey time: 50–65 minutes.

Local A-road fast-track: A40 (Cheltenham–Gloucester–Ross-on-Wye) for onward connections to midlands manufacturers and Welsh aerospace suppliers. A44 (Cheltenham–Evesham) and A435 (Cheltenham–Redditch) also provide regional bypass routes.

Chain of Custody and Paperwork

Aviation AOG logistics demands absolute traceability. Every T&C Logistics shipment from Cheltenham includes:

Signed Proof of Delivery (POD): Driver captures signature (or named recipient acknowledgement) at handover. Digital POD images are uploaded to our tracking system within minutes of delivery.

GPS Tracking: All vehicles carry live GPS units. Customers receive a tracking URL valid for 48 hours post-delivery, allowing real-time visibility of collection, transit, and arrival.

NDA-Briefed Drivers: All T&C Logistics drivers operating AOG runs sign a standard non-disclosure agreement covering competitive, technical, and security-sensitive information. We brief drivers on the specific sensitivity level of each shipment (standard, sensitive, highly restricted).

Customs & Export Paperwork: For any shipments with international components (e.g. spares from EU suppliers routed onward), we coordinate with cargo handlers on Commercial Invoices, Carriage notes, and (if applicable) export/import declarations.

Handover Protocol: At airport cargo handlers (Swissport, Menzies Aviation, dnata, DHL, Kuehne+Nagel, DB Schenker), we ensure signed release by the authorised cargo agent, and return a copy of their receipt to the shipper within the same working day.

What We Do Not Offer from Cheltenham

Transparency is essential. T&C Logistics does not operate the following from Cheltenham or any location:

Airside operations: We do not hold airside passes, airside credentials, or licences to drive or operate on active airport runways, ramps, or taxiways. We coordinate with authorised cargo handlers (Swissport, Menzies Aviation, dnata, DHL, Kuehne+Nagel, DB Schenker) who manage landside handover and onward airside movement on behalf of airlines and freight forwarders.

Locked-cage van fleet: We do not operate locked, armoured, or cage-fitted vehicles at scale, and do not hold specialist secure transport certifications (NPPV or DV clearance).

Controlled goods handling: We do not hold licences for controlled drugs, explosives, or military-grade restricted items. High-security aerospace items (defence-related components) may require specialist carriers; we can refer on request.

MIA (Materials In Bond) or bonded warehouse operations: We do not operate bonded storage or in-bond consolidation facilities. Items in customs custody require bonded warehouse operators.

For any of these services, we will connect you with specialist partner carriers or refer you to appropriate UK regulatory bodies.

What happens if the cargo includes restricted items (e.g. batteries or fluids) for AOG delivery?
We comply with IATA and UK aviation regulations for restricted goods. Lithium batteries, fluids, corrosives, and other restricted items must be declared at booking with full technical details (UN class, packing group, quantity). We work with the cargo handler to ensure compliant labelling and documentation. If an item falls outside our standard scope (e.g. explosives or military-grade items), we will advise and refer you to a specialist carrier.
